Best time to go to Koh Tao

If you're planning a trip to Koh Tao,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is May.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January80.8°F (27.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ly High
February81.1°F (27.3°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verage
March82.4°F (28.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ly High
April83.8°F (28.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verage
May84.7°F (29.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ly Low
June84.0°F (28.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verage
July83.3°F (28.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ly High
August83.1°F (28.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verage
September82.6°F (28.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verage
October82.2°F (27.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
November82.2°F (27.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
December81.3°F (27.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verage

Seasonal weather in Koh Tao

Travellers speak highly of Koh Tao for its diving and boating. If warm-weather activities are high on your list, May, June, April and July are the hottest months to visit, when temperatures average 29°C.

Travelling to and around Koh Tao

Fly into Samui Intl. Airport (USM), the closest airport, located 41.2 mi (66.3 km) from the city centre.
